Is there a quick way to invert text objects?

A. Although you can rotate objects by clicking the Free Rotate button on the Drawing toolbar, there is an even quicker way. Simply select the text box that contains the object. Then, drag one of the top handles downward until the cursor is below the bottom margin of the object, and release the mouse button. The text object is now upside down, as if you’d rotated 180 degrees. You can save a slide presentation as a series of Web pages complete with navigation buttons using the Save as HTML Wizard in PowerPoint. To use this Wizard you must install the Web Page Authoring (HTML) application from your Office 97 CD.
